NIH director to step down ahead of Trump inauguration
National Institutes of Health director Monica Bertagnolli will resign on Jan. 17, she told staff this week, ending her tenure leading the $48 billion biomedical research agency after only a year.
“I am so proud of what NIH has been able to achieve in such a short time under my leadership,” Bertagnolli said in her announcement, touting a list of initiatives launched that she hopes the next administration will continue.
